________________ SUPĀRSVANATHACARITRA 313 Master went to Mt. Sammeta. There the Master of the World, attended by gods and asuras, together with five hundred munis began a fast. At the end of a month, on the seventh day of the black half of Phalguna, the moon being in Mula, the Master and the munis went to an eternal abode. Śri Supārsva passed five lacs of purvas as prince; fourteen lacs of purvas and twenty purvāngas in governing the earth; and a lac of purvas less twenty pūrvängas in the vow. So his age was twenty lacs of purvas. Supārsva Svämin's nirvana was nine thousand crores of sagaropamas after Sri Padmaprabha's nirvāṇa. The Indras, Acyuta, etc., celebrated a great emancipation-festival accompanied by the funeral rites of the Master and the munis.
